Transaction 105ac0088a36fca47d9b662bb6a2039b31e80aec52b371e20308b91f3490dae5

1 Input
2 Outputs
  • 105ac0088a36fca47d9b662bb6a2039b31e80aec52b371e20308b91f3490dae5:0
  • value  1661899
    address  19MxR3XtkZCcz1AvC37oYvtzFEMmm1zr1A
  • 105ac0088a36fca47d9b662bb6a2039b31e80aec52b371e20308b91f3490dae5:1
  • value  24792
    address  3EUU14PHbKXey8QCXhhtz6XR7GT6RFfJ5v